4x^3-7x^2+x+x^3 like terms

4x^3−7x^2+x+x^3

=4x^3+−7x^2+x+x^3

Combine Like Terms:

=4x^3+−7x^2+x+x^3

=(4x^3+x^3)+(−7x^2)+(x)

=5x^3−7x^2+x
